云上安全:如何在AWS等云平台上建立安全的基础架构?
云上安全:如何在AWS等云平台上建立安全的基础架构?
随着云计算的快速发展,越来越多的企业开始将应用程序和数据迁移到云上。但是,与此同时,也带来了更多的安全威胁和挑战。云平台提供商如AWS已经提供了一些安全措施来保护用户的数据和应用程序,但是建立一个安全的基础架构还需要更多的工作。
下面是一些在AWS等云平台上建立安全基础架构的技术知识点:
1. 访问控制和身份验证
访问控制和身份验证是任何安全基础架构的核心。在AWS上,可以使用IAM(身份和访问管理)来创建和管理用户、组和角色。IAM允许您定义精细的访问策略,以限制用户可以访问的资源和操作。
2. 网络安全
在云上建立安全的网络,需要使用安全组、网络ACL和VPC等AWS服务。安全组是虚拟防火墙,允许您控制进出实例的流量。网络ACL是子网级别的防火墙,它允许您控制进出VPC的流量。VPC是一种虚拟网络,它允许您定义网络拓扑,并使用不同的安全组和ACL来控制流量。
3. 数据加密
AWS提供了许多数据加密选项,包括加密存储和加密传输。S3(简单存储服务)支持服务器端加密和客户端加密。通过AWS KMS(密钥管理服务),可以轻松地管理加密密钥。
4. 日志和监控
对于一个安全的基础架构,必须有完整的日志和监控。AWS提供了CloudTrail和CloudWatch等服务,可以帮助您跟踪所有API调用和资源活动。这些服务还允许您设置警报和通知,以及构建基于日志数据的安全分析。
5. 安全审计和合规性
进行安全审计和合规性检查是保护数据和应用程序的关键。AWS提供了许多工具和服务,以帮助您证明您的基础架构符合各种合规性要求。这些服务包括AWS Config、AWS Trusted Advisor和AWS Artifact等。
总结:
在云平台上建立安全的基础架构需要完整的安全策略和计划。它需要合理的访问控制、网络安全、数据加密、日志和监控,以及安全审计和合规性检查。使用AWS提供的各种服务和工具,可以帮助您建立开放、安全的基础架构。但是,一旦建立基础架构,就需要持续监控和更新,以保持数据和应用程序的安全性。
相关推荐HOT
更多>>如何使用Linux自带的监控工具,捕捉服务器技术问题?
如何使用Linux自带的监控工具,捕捉服务器技术问题?在Linux系统中,有很多自带的监控工具可以帮助我们捕捉服务器技术问题。本文将介绍其中一些...详情>>
2023-12-24 23:44:03权限管理在网络安全中的重要性
权限管理在网络安全中的重要性随着网络的迅速发展,网络安全问题变得越来越突出。在保证网络安全的同时,越来越多的企业和组织开始关注用户权限...详情>>
2023-12-24 22:32:03网络安全:升级您的防护措施
网络安全:升级您的防护措施网络安全一直是互联网时代最重要的话题之一,尤其是在今天,随着网络攻击越来越复杂,网络安全已经不再是一个简单的...详情>>
2023-12-24 11:44:03你的电脑是否已经被黑客入侵?如何检测和清除恶意软件?
你的电脑是否已经被黑客入侵?如何检测和清除恶意软件?随着互联网的快速发展,黑客入侵已经成了一个不可避免的现象。许多人的电脑可能已经被黑...详情>>
2023-12-24 10:32:03热门推荐
如何使用Linux自带的监控工具,捕捉服务器技术问题?
沸权限管理在网络安全中的重要性
热从0到1构建自己的云服务器,让你成为一位云计算架构师!
热如何应对内部员工的恶意攻击?
新如何检测和解决网络安全漏洞?
云安全技术的最新进展与应用
如何应对Ransomware攻击:数据备份与恢复指南
网络安全警钟长鸣:从零开始构建完美的企业安全防护体系
网络安全管理:这8个实用技巧可以帮你减少攻击的风险!
网络安全:升级您的防护措施
你的电脑是否已经被黑客入侵?如何检测和清除恶意软件?
常见网络漏洞分析及应对方案
基础设施攻防战:如何保障电力、水利等能源网络的安全?
如何识别和避免网络钓鱼攻击